Stricter Medical Screenings for SASSA Disability Grants: What South Africans Need to Know This August

Stricter Medical Screenings for SASSA Disability Grants: The South African Social Security Agency (SASSA) has announced enhanced medical screenings for disability grant applicants this August. This initiative aims to ensure that only those who genuinely qualify receive support, aligning with national priorities to optimize resource distribution. This change comes amid ongoing discussions about the sustainability of social grants in the country, and it is crucial for potential applicants to understand the implications of these new measures. With August marking the rollout of these screenings, applicants must be adequately prepared to navigate the updated processes. This article delves into the nuances of these stricter screenings, offering insights into what applicants need to know and how they can approach the application process effectively.

Understanding the New SASSA Medical Screening Process

The revised medical screening process for SASSA disability grants is designed to be more comprehensive, ensuring that only those with valid medical conditions receive support. This decision follows an increase in the number of applicants and the need to prevent fraudulent claims, which have put a strain on the system. Under the new guidelines, medical assessments will be more detailed and involve a thorough examination by qualified medical professionals.

  • Applicants must present valid medical documentation.
  • In-person assessments may be required for verification.
  • Medical reviews will be conducted periodically to ensure ongoing eligibility.
  • Applicants must disclose all relevant medical history.
  • Fraudulent claims may result in penalties and disqualification.

Navigating the SASSA Application Process

Applying for a SASSA disability grant under the new guidelines requires careful planning and attention to detail. The first step is to gather all necessary medical documentation that clearly outlines the nature and extent of the disability. This includes recent medical reports, diagnostic tests, and certifications from registered healthcare providers. Understanding the eligibility criteria is crucial, as is ensuring that all forms are thoroughly completed and submitted within the required timelines.

Key Steps for Applicants:

  • Collect comprehensive medical records.
  • Ensure documents are current and certified.
  • Understand eligibility requirements thoroughly.
  • Submit applications on time to avoid delays.
  • Prepare for potential in-person assessments.

Table: Key Documents Required for SASSA Application

Document Type Details
Medical Report Issued by a registered healthcare provider
Diagnostic Test Results Recent results supporting the claim
Identification Document Certified copy of ID or birth certificate
Proof of Residence Recent utility bill or official letter
